Questions about Nier
What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?
Terrier/Shiba Inu mixes do well in homes that can provide them with moderate exercise and mental stimulation. They adapt to both houses with yards and well-managed apartments, as long as their physical and social needs are met.
How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?
Medium outdoor space is ideal for a Terrier/Shiba Inu mix, such as a securely fenced yard. However, daily walks and play sessions are often sufficient even in smaller spaces if activity is regularly provided.
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?
Yes, both terriers and Shiba Inu mixes can make great family dogs and are usually suitable for homes with children, especially when socialized from an early age. As with all breeds, supervision is recommended around young children.
